About the role
- The Patient Care Coordinator interacts with patients over the phone to coordinate prescription refill(s), updates billing information, and addresses patient concerns.
- This position redirects calls to pharmacists as needed, communicates with healthcare providers in a confidential manner, and adheres to applicable healthcare regulations.
- To accommodate business and patient services, this position may be required to work varied and rotating full-time schedules between 8:00 a.m.-8:00 p.m., Monday-Friday as required by the Manager.
- Communicates with patients via phone to establish rapport, ensure clinical compliance, and establish next shipment of medication.
- Communicates with order management and fulfillment team to engage compliance, and to address concerns as noted during patient communication.
- Accepts direction from pharmacist(s) and Leadership regarding various elements of specialty call compliance programs.
- Completes all Patient Care Coordinator responsibilities fluently in both English and Spanish.
- Additional projects and activities as assigned.
Requirements
- High school diploma or graduate education degree (GED).
- 1-3 years customer service experience in a call center environment.
- Excellent communication, organizational and interpersonal skills.
- Bilingual – Fluent in English and Spanish, especially in medical terms.
- Preferred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ree.
- 1-3 years’ experience in a specialty pharmacy call center environment.
- Healthcare interpreter certification from a nationally recognized institute (Certification Commission for Healthcare Interpreters or the National Board of Certification for Medical Interpreters) or willingness to become certified.
